cristianotestai Posted November 16, 2011 Share Posted November 16, 2011 Hi Farshad, Use the event below to place an image in UniEdit and works ok! OnAfterrender function (sender) { sender.getEl().setStyle('background-image', "url ([url="http://localhost:8077/ext-3.4.0/resources/images/search.gif"]http://localhost:807...ages/search.gif[/url])"); } What I am not able to do is use the Event "OnEnter" of "UniEdit" to add in runtime the UniSession.AddJS command under certain condition. I'm trying: procedure TfmContato.edFiltroNomeEnter(Sender: TObject); begin if (edFiltroNome.Text = 'buscar') and (edFiltroNome.Font.Color = $00B5B5B5) then begin UniSession.AddJS('fmHome.edFiltroNome.getEl().setStyle(' + QuotedStr('background-image') + ', "url([url="http://localhost:8077/ext-3.4.0/resources/images/search.gif"]http://localhost:807...ages/search.gif[/url])");'); end; end; And AjaxError occurs: Can not call method 'getEl' of undefined. I do not understand why that the method is not defined, if it is used in OnAfterrrender, where the object "edFiltroNome" is the same object. How to do the same as the event OnAfterrender at runtime using the UniSession.AddJS and also, how to eliminate the code in the event OnExit later? Attached the error image. Thanks.
